Why does Security = Conspiracy?


I have noticed on this show that when these guys go to all of these places like Area 51, AUTEC, or weapons proving grounds, whatever, they try to make it look like normal security is some sort of big cover up.

The problem is that a lot of these places they want to check out deal in military and defense, there is going to be security. The fact that the security people do their job is nothing evil, but they always make it out to be like the Men In Black swoop in and foil their attempts at finding the "truth". They act like some security person sitting in a truck guarding the perimeter is something insidious.

Tonight I see the episode where they go to AUTEC, a Coast Guard helicopter takes off from the place as they approach the front gate, and they automatically assume it is watching them. The thing flies off, it's not like it followed them around, but they were saying "he's definitely watching us", but he was so far away you couldn't even see if the pilot was looking at them or what. Then a police car drives by, passes them up completely and goes inside, and they think that is there for them too, and just leave assuming all of this was on their behalf. What a mixture of paranoia and delusions of grandeur that was. The whole thing was just dumb, why even launch a helicopter when they were within spitting distance of a guard gate.
